The England Under-19 squads to face Middlesex second XI in three one-day matches next month have been announced.

Two squads have been named, the first contesting back-to-back games on April 15 and 16 and the second to meet the Second XI Trophy winners on April 18. All three matches will take place at Radlett CC.

Kent’s Alex Blake was called up as a replacement for all-rounder James Harris, who is unavailable after being selected to play for Glamorgan against Oxford UCCE ahead of the LV County Championship season.
